0.156" Pitch, 8-Position MTA-156 Header — What It Carries

The 1-641938-1: The header itself doesn't set the current ceiling; the terminal and wire do. Rated for 600VAC, with a UL94 V-0 glass-filled thermoplastic housing that holds up in industrial and general-purpose equipment.

Friction Lock and Single-Wall Shroud — Retention vs Protection

The friction lock provides a positive detent when mated with the matching MTA-156 receptacle — it holds against moderate vibration but won't resist a hard yank on the cable. For higher shock environments, consider a header with a detent lock or secondary latch. The shroud covers only one wall (the back side of the header), leaving the front of the pins exposed. This prevents solder bridges from shorting to the board behind the header, but doesn't protect the pin tips from debris during handling. Full 4-wall shrouded headers like the 1-292164-1 (0.079" pitch) or 1379030-3 (0.100" pitch) offer more mechanical protection at the cost of a larger footprint.

Is 1-641938-1 shrouded?

Yes, it is shrouded on one wall (the back side). The front of the pins is exposed, which means the header protects against backplane shorts but not front-side debris. For full 4-wall shrouding, look at the 1-292164-1 or 1379030-3 peers.
